Learning outcomes

1.
Describe the principles of research organisation and planning.
2.
Apply theoretical and practical aspects of research design, including use of qualitative and quantitative approaches to research.
3.
Demonstrate skills in the use of computers, databases, statistical and graphics packages for performing research and communicating the findings.
4.
Demonstrate high quality research and writing skills in your research thesis or report.
5.
Effectively use oral communication skills in a professional environment.

Additional information

Unit content:This unit covers the following specific areas: • Designing and preparing research proposals • Using the literature for devising and evaluating research • Critical review of the literature • Theoretical underpinning of research methodology and problem-solving • Critical thinking • Oral communication skills • Thesis writing, abstracts and research design • Poster preparation and presentation • Instruction on key practical skills used in conducting research, such as computer packages, internet resources, and library facilities.
Other notes:Honours students are advised to complete this unit in their first semester of enrolment.
